She studied philosophy and literature at the university of buenos aires before dropping out to pursue painting and her own poetry. Pizarnik was born into a family of jewish immigrants from eastern europe.

Flora alejandra pizarnik 19361972 was born to russian jewish parents in an immigrant district of buenos aires. Pizarnik writes at the edge of poetic impossibility, opening with a blues singer, expanding into silence, and closing into a theater of. In 1960, she moved to paris, where she befriended writers such as octavio paz, julio cortazar, and silvina ocampo.
